Title:
SYSTEM AND METHOD OF MANAGING USE RECORD OF HOME NETWORK DEVICES
Document Type and Number:
WIPO Patent Application WO/2008/013379
Kind Code:
A2
Abstract:
A system and method of managing a use record of home network devices is provided, which collects status information of various kinds of in-house devices and sensors using a room controller and manages a use record of the home network devices. The system of managing a use record of home network devices, includes: a room controller which collects control and status information of the home network devices, a home gateway portion which transmits the collected information to an out-of-house place; a central management server system which stores and analyzes the transmitted information and manages a use record of the home network devices; a call center terminal which receives breakdown or alarm information from the central management server system and transmits the received breakdown or alarm information to a user or an after-service (A/S) system; and a remote control user interface which remotely controls the home network devices through the central management server system, and enables the user to make inquiries as to a use record of the home network devices.

[23] Hereinbelow, a system and method of managing a use record of home network devices according to a preferred embodiment of the present invention will be described in more detail with reference to the accompanying drawings.

[24] FIG. 1 is a block diagram showing a system of managing a use record of home network devices according to an exemplary embodiment of the present invention. The system of managing a use record of home network devices shown in FIG. 1 includes:

home network devices 10 including various kinds of devices and sensors which are installed in a building such as a house or office; a room controller 20 which is linked in communication with the home network devices 10 by power line or by wire, to thereby control the home network devices 10 and collect status information of the home network devices 10; and telephone network/Internet home gateways 30A and 30B which are linked in communication with the room controller 20 by power line, transmit the collected status information to an out-of-house place, and receive control instruction from the out-of-house place.

[25] In addition, the system of FIG. 1 also includes: a central management server system

40 which is linked with the in-house home gateways 30A and 30B via a telephone network such as a PSTN (Public Switched Telephone Network) network or the Internet network, receives breakdown/alarm information and a log of use/state information of the home network devices 10, stores and analyzes the transmitted information and manages a use record of the home network devices 10; a call center terminal 50 which receives breakdown or alarm information from the central management server system 40 and transmits the received breakdown or alarm information to a user or an after- service (A/S) system 60; and a remote control user interface 70 which remotely controls the in-house home network devices 10 through the central management server system 40, and enables the user to make inquiries as to a use record of the home network devices 10.

[26] Here, the central management server system 40 includes: a private branch exchanger

(PBX) 41 such as unPBX which changes breakdown/alarm information of a tone signal mode that is transferred through the PSTN network to a packet mode; a management server 43 which transfers control instruction that is applied from the remote control user interface 70 to the Internet home gateway 30B, receives log/ state/breakdown/alarm information that is transferred from the Internet home gateway 30B and manages a use record of the home network devices 10; and a database (DB) 45 which stores the collected information.

[27] The management server 43 includes: an authentication module 431 which executes user authentication with respect to log information; an information processor 432 which analyzes and processes log/state/breakdown/alarm information; a web server 433 that supports Internet connection; a remote control processing module 434 which handles a request from the remote control user interface 70.

[28] An operation of managing a use record of the home network devices in the FIG. 1 system having the above-described structure will be described in more detail with reference to FIGS. 2 and 3.

[29] In the case of an in-house user, he or she manipulates the room controller 20 directly.

Otherwise, in the case of an out-of-house user, he or she remotely manipulates and

controls the in-house home network devices 10, via the remote control user interface 70 such as a personal computer (PC), a cellular phone, or a personal digital assistant (PDA). The remote control user interface 70 connects to the central management server system 40, and sends control instruction to the Internet home gateway 30B through the central management server system 40. The management server 43 of the central management server system 40 transmits the control instruction to the in-house home gateway 30B through the Internet network. The in-house Internet home gateway 30B transmits the received control instruction in communication to the room controller 20 by power line. The room controller 20 controls operation of a corresponding device among the linked home network devices 10 according to the input control instruction. Various kinds of in-house devices and sensors, that is, home network products of a boiler, lighting devices, an intrusion detection sensor, a gas circuit breaker, a door lock, etc., are linked with the room controller 20.

[30] On the other hand, the room controller 20 receives status information from the linked home network devices 10 and transfers the received status information to the home gateways 30A and 30B. The telephone network home gateway 30A collects breakdown or alarm information of the home network devices 10 and transmits the collected breakdown or alarm information to the out-of -house central management server system 40 via a PSTN network. Since the information transferred via the PSTN network is a tone signal of a phone call, the central management server system 40 changes the information of the tone signal to information of an appropriate packet mode through a private branch exchanger 41 such as UnPBX and stores the change result in a database (DB) 45. The Internet home gateway 30B collects log, state, breakdown or alarm information of the home network devices 10 and transfers the collected information to the out-of-house central management server system 40 through the Internet network. Since the information transferred through the Internet network is of a packet mode, the management server 43 of the central management server system 40 stores the received information in the database (DB) 45 as it is. The information processor 432 of the management server 43 analyzes a use record of log, state, breakdown, alarm, etc., from the information stored in the database (DB) 45 and also stores the analyzed result in the database (DB) 45 to thereby make a user to always make inquiries for the use record. That is, a user may connect to the web server 433 of the management server 43 through the remote control user interface 70, and inquire for the user record of the log, breakdown, etc., which have been stored in the database (DB) 45. [34] The management server 43 transfers breakdown or alarm information to the call center terminal 50, and notifies a user or an after-service (A/S) system 60 of the breakdown or alarm information, to thereby enable the user or the after-service (A/S) system 60 to perform a quick and accurate after-service (A/S) for the corresponding home network devices 10. That is, the call center terminal 50 receives the breakdown or alarm information from the database (DB) 45, and transmits contents of the breakdown or alarm information to a cellular phone of the user through a short message service (SMS) or to a personal digital assistant (PDA) of an A/S engineer. Because the A/S engineer received the contents of the breakdown or alarm information before he or she visits a home where any of the home network devices 10 have been troubled, he or she can do a correct after-service (A/S) without asking a customer of the contents of the breakdown or alarm information during visiting.

[35] Meanwhile, a log information collection process about user information will be described with reference to FIG. 2. [36] In FIG. 2, the room controller 20 collects log information through power line com-

munication with the home network devices 10 (step 201). The Internet home gateway 3OB creates data about log information collected by the room controller 20 (step 202). The Internet home gateway 30B transmits the created log data to the management server 43 of the central management server system 40 through the Internet network (step 203). The management server 43 stores the received log data in the database (DB) 45 (step 204). The management server 43 reads the log data stored in the database (DB) 45, according to a user's log data inquiry request through the remote control user interface 70 of a personal computer (PC) or a cellular phone, a personal digital assistant (PDA), etc., and changes the read log data into a suitable user interface (UI) to then be provided for the user (step 205). The management server 43 deletes the stored log information periodically on a first-come-first-delete basis, in order to secure a storage space for the database (DB) 45 (step 206).

[37] FIG. 3 illustrates a process when breakdown occurs in the home network devices 10.

When breakdown occurs in the home network devices 10 (step 301), the home gateways 30A and 30B having received the breakdown or alarm information through the room controller 20 create breakdown data (step 302). That is, the home gateways 30A and 30B create breakdown or alarm information collected by the room controller 20 as breakdown data. Otherwise, the home gateways 30A and 30B communicate with the home network devices 10 periodically, and then judges as device breakdown if it is not communicated any more between the room controller 20 and the home network devices 10, to thus create breakdown data. The home gateways 30A and 30B transmit the created breakdown data to the central management server system 40 through the PSTN network or the Internet network (step 303). The central management server system 40 receives the breakdown data and stores the received breakdown data in the database (DB) 45 (step 304), and simultaneously changes the received breakdown data into a suitable user interface (UI) to then be transferred to the call center terminal 50, so as to be used as data necessary when a call center counselor consults (step 305). The call center terminal 50 transmits the breakdown data to the user as needed by a short message service (SMS) and notifies the user of the occurrence of the breakdown of the home network devices 10 (step 306). The user who has been notified of the SMS breakdown data can consult with a call center counselor through a call-back (step 307), and the call center terminal 50 transmits the breakdown data to the A/S system 60 upon the user's A/S request (step 308), so that an A/S engineer can visit a home where any of the home network devices 10 have been troubled and trouble-shoots the corresponding troubled home network devices 10 (step 309).

[38] As described above, a system and method of managing a use record of home network devices, according to the present invention receives breakdown, log, and status information of various kinds of devices and sensors which are linked with an in-house

home controller, through home gateways to then be centrally managed, and thus immediately recognize occurrence of breakdown of the home network devices. In addition, the system and method of managing a use record of home network devices, according to the present invention, enables any troubled home network devices to be A/S-executed without explaining an A/S engineer about the breakdown contents one by one. Further, the present invention provides the user or the A/S engineer with an effect of making him or her grasp a use record of the troubled product at a look.
